
BiteSpeed Hits $5 Million ARR, Plans Expansion with New AI Tools

- BiteSpeed hits $5 million in annual recurring revenue (ARR) with 250% YoY growth.
- The AI powered CRM serves over 5,000 e-commerce brands across 50+ countries.
- Plans to double ARR to $10 million and expand team size to 100+ by end of 2025.
Bengaluru based startup BiteSpeed has crossed a major milestone, hitting $5 million in annual recurring revenue (ARR). The AI first CRM platform, built specifically for e-commerce brands, reported a 250% year on year growth and now has its sights set on $10 million ARR by the end of 2025.
Founded in 2019 by Vinayak Aggarwal, BiteSpeed helps online brands manage marketing and support across channels like WhatsApp, Instagram, Email, SMS, Voice, and Web Chat all from one AI powered dashboard. The platform uses conversational AI to recover abandoned carts, send personalised updates, re-engage inactive users, and deliver real time support, helping brands drive conversions and reduce complexity.
BiteSpeed has gained strong momentum with over 5,000 e-commerce brands using its platform across more than 50 countries. Clients include top Indian D2C names like Dot & Key, Mokobara, Minimalist, Bombay Shaving Company, mCaffeine, and Zouk. The platform has also seen growing adoption in international markets such as the UK, Middle East, South Africa, and Australia.

Vinayak Aggarwal, Founder & CEO of BiteSpeed said “Crossing $5 million in ARR reflects the value we bring to our customers”. He added, “As e-commerce brands scale, they need AI tools that turn every conversation into revenue. That’s what BiteSpeed delivers”.
Backed by Peak XV’s Surge, Whiteboard Capital, and Kunal Shah, the startup is preparing to roll out new AI driven features like AI voice agents and AI native email marketing to further increase revenue impact for brands.
To fuel this next phase of growth, BiteSpeed aims to scale its team to over 100 employees by the end of the year.
